Chemical Week Magazine :: New Construction Projects JGC Confirms Deal to Expand Petro Rabigh’s Ethane Cracker8:00 AM MDT | August 17, 2012 JGC has confirmed CW’s exclusive report that the company will be responsible for the previously announced expansion of Petro Rabigh’s ethane cracker at Rabigh, Saudi Arabia. JGC signed a deal to add 300,000 m.t./year of ethylene capacity at the cracker, which will raise the plant’s total to 1.6 million m.t./year. The ethylene hike forms part of the Rabigh II project, a $7-billion expansion program by Saudi Aramco and Sumitomo Chemical, the joint owners of Petro Rabigh.
